This example demonstrates how to create a custom connector plugin for Mycel using WebAssembly (WASM).
A Mycel plugin is a directory containing:
my-plugin/
├── plugin.hcl # Plugin manifest (required)
├── connector.wasm # WASM connector module (required for connectors)
└── functions.wasm # WASM functions module (optional)
The plugin.hcl file describes the plugin and what it provides:
plugin {
name = "salesforce"
version = "1.0.0"
description = "Salesforce CRM connector for Mycel"
author = "Your Name"
license = "MIT"
}
provides {
connector "salesforce" {
wasm = "connector.wasm"
config {
instance_url = "string"
client_id = "string"
client_secret = {
type = "string"
required = true
sensitive = true
}
username = "string"
password = {
type = "string"
sensitive = true
}
}
}
# Optional: provide custom functions for CEL expressions
functions {
wasm = "functions.wasm"
exports = ["sf_format_id", "sf_parse_date"]
}
}Declare plugins in your Mycel configuration:
# plugins.hcl
plugin "salesforce" {
source = "./plugins/salesforce"
}
# For git-hosted plugins (future):
# plugin "stripe" {
# source = "github.com/acme/mycel-stripe"
# version = "~> 1.0"
# }Then use the plugin connector like any built-in connector:
# connectors/salesforce.hcl
connector "sf_crm" {
type = "salesforce" # Uses the plugin connector type
instance_url = env("SF_INSTANCE_URL")
client_id = env("SF_CLIENT_ID")
client_secret = env("SF_CLIENT_SECRET")
username = env("SF_USERNAME")
password = env("SF_PASSWORD")
}Use it in flows:
# flows/get_accounts.hcl
flow "get_accounts" {
from {
connector = "api"
operation = "GET /accounts"
}
to {
connector = "sf_crm"
target = "Account"
operation = "SELECT"
}
}Your WASM connector must export these functions:
init(config: JSON) -> JSON- Initialize with configurationread(query: JSON) -> JSON- Read/query datawrite(data: JSON) -> JSON- Write/modify data
health() -> JSON- Health checkclose() -> JSON- Cleanup resourcescall(operation: JSON) -> JSON- RPC-style operations
All functions receive and return JSON:
init input:
{
"instance_url": "https://myorg.salesforce.com",
"client_id": "...",
"client_secret": "..."
}read input:
{
"target": "Account",
"operation": "SELECT",
"filters": {"Industry": "Technology"},
"fields": ["Id", "Name", "Industry"],
"pagination": {"limit": 100, "offset": 0}
}write input:
{
"target": "Account",
"operation": "INSERT",
"payload": {"Name": "Acme Corp", "Industry": "Technology"}
}Response format:
{
"data": [...],
"metadata": {
"affected": 1,
"id": "001xxx..."
}
}Error response:
{
"error": "Failed to connect: invalid credentials"

cargo build --target wasm32-wasi --releaseWASM modules communicate with Mycel via shared memory:
- Input: Mycel writes JSON to WASM memory and passes (pointer, length)
- Output: WASM function returns a packed u64:
(pointer << 32) | length - Allocation: Export
alloc(size: u32) -> u32for Mycel to allocate memory - Deallocation: Export
free(ptr: u32, size: u32)for cleanup
